Hackers Exploit Webview2 to Deploy CoinLurker Malware and Evade Security Detection


Bogus software update lures are being used by threat actors to deliver a new stealer malware called CoinLurker.
“Written in Go, CoinLurker employs cutting-edge obfuscation and anti-analysis techniques, making it a highly effective tool in modern cyber attacks,” Morphisec researcher Nadav Lorber said in a technical report published Monday.
